About Us Advinia has been providing high quality, person‑centred care, specialised for older people and focusing on resident wellbeing for over 25 years. We operate 36 care homes across the UK. Each is led by a team of experienced and dedicated care professionals who are committed to always prioritising the individual needs of residents. Our mission is guided by the B‑Happie theme, creating an environment where residents and staff feel valued, respected and happy. We promote three key pillars to keep our residents feeling connected, relaxed and safe. For staff, we help them feel fulfilled, recognised and purposeful.
Your role will include:
- Working closely with the Maintenance Manager or nominated colleague to ensure residents live in a safe and well‑maintained environment at all times.
- Ensuring that regular safety checks and servicing is carried out on all equipment and that accurate records are kept.
- Providing basic plumbing and electrical maintenance.
- Clearing and cleaning general areas.
- Assembling furniture.
- Painting and decorating.
- Performing on‑call duties as required.
- Maintaining excellent communication with the Home Manager, residents, colleagues and visitors.
